The Working Model of an App like GOAT
A sneaker app like GOAT is an online marketplace where users can purchase, sell, and trade sneakers. The software streamlines the purchasing and selling process by bringing together sneakerheads from all over the world. An overview of the working model of an app like GOAT is provided below.
1. The Buying Process
With a sneaker app like a goat, it's easy to buy. To begin with, consumers can look for sneakers by brand, size, price, and style. A comprehensive description of each pair, including multiple images, status details, and size availability, is displayed through the app. After selecting a pair, customers can purchase it directly from the app.
2. Selling Sneakers on GOAT
GOAT makes it simple to list your sneakers if you're trying to sell them. Sneakers' condition, size, and other details can be described in images that sellers post. Customers can buy the sneakers after they are listed.
3. Authentication and Quality Control
The rigorous verification and quality control procedure of GOAT is one of its most notable characteristics. A group of professionals inspects each pair of sneakers before sending them to the customer. Since authenticity and quality are major issues in the sneaker market, this is done to guarantee that every sneaker is 100% authentic.
4. Secure Payment and Shipping
Secure delivery and payment methods are also top priorities for a sneaker app like GOAT. The software retains the money until the sneakers are verified and dispatched after a customer makes a purchase. This guarantees the protection of the buyer's funds. Similarly, sellers don't receive payment until the buyer confirms receipt of their sneakers and the transaction is finalized.
The Emerging Features of A Marketplace App Like GOAT
When you build a modern sneaker marketplace app, you need features that people need and trust. New and contemporary features help your app stand out from the crowd. Here are some key ones that are becoming important:
1. Authenticity Verification
A marketplace like GOAT uses experts to inspect sneakers. They check details such as stitching, materials, and packaging. Some apps also utilize artificial intelligence-based image recognition to match sneakers with their authentic counterparts. Thus, the verification process builds trust and makes users feel safe.
2. Virtual Try-On Technology
This feature uses augmented reality. It allows buyers to try on sneakers using their phone camera. The user can see how the sneakers may look on their feet in real-time. This adds fun to shopping. It also reduces uncertainty. Buyers can feel confident before making a purchase.
3. Real-time Bidding System
Instead of fixed prices, some platforms allow buyers to bid to place offers. Sellers can accept offers or make counteroffers. This creates a lively marketplace experience. It can lead sellers to get better prices. It can also make buyers feel more involved.
4. Community Engagement Tools
Modern apps go beyond buying and selling. They also build a community. Features could include a feed for sneaker news. Or a forum for discussion. Style guides help users learn how to wear sneakers. Release calendars let users know about upcoming drops. This builds loyalty. Users stay in the app longer. They return frequently.
5. Secure Payment and Wallet Integration
People want safe payment options, which is why an app like GOAT offers secure payment methods, including credit and debit cards, digital currencies, and UPI. Also, allow payment in cryptocurrency. Sellers can store the money they earn, allowing them to use that balance to purchase more from the platform. This removes friction, making the user experience smoother.
6. AI-Based Product Suggestions
AI is able to analyze user behavior. It sees surf patterns, buying, and search history. After that, it provides recommendations for footwear based on the user's interests. It provides shopping facilities. Because recommendations are more relevant to the customer's needs, it also increases sales.
7. Advanced Search and Filters
Users require strong tools when searching for footwear. They can find exactly what they're looking for with the use of an app that has numerous filters. They have the option to filter by sneaker type, year of release, price, size, brand, and even condition. Those who prefer to talk rather than type can also benefit from voice search. This increases satisfaction and saves time.
8. Inventory Management for Sellers
Sellers need tools to easily manage their items. They get a dashboard. They can upload photos. They set a price. They see how many hits their listing gets. They can respond to buyer messages. They can track shipping and reviews. When their selling process is organized, it improves their experience. It increases their loyalty to the platform.
9. Push Notifications and Alerts
Users stay informed thanks to notifications. They may notify you of a new release, a price reduction, or an update on the status of your order. Additionally, promotional offers show up right away. Users are kept interested by timely messaging. This improves retention. Additionally, it speeds up transactions.
10. Analytics Dashboard
The analytics dashboard feature facilitates admins, helping them to monitor everything. Data about user behavior is shown on a dashboard. It displays the best-selling items. It displays the features that users interact with. It displays patterns in revenue. The team can make well-informed judgments because of these insights. They can change prices, enter new markets, or improve marketing. Data supports targeted growth.
11. In App Chat and Customer Support
The key is communication. Users can communicate directly with vendors or customer service representatives using an integrated chat function. They can inquire about the legitimacy, shipment, or condition. Quick responses provide users with a sense of security. This fosters trust. Refunds and complaints have also decreased.

How to Make Money from a Marketplace App Like GOAT?
A sneaker marketplace can generate revenue through multiple strategies. Here are the primary revenue sources that could help the businesses generate income from the app.
1. Commission on Sales
Every time a sale completes, the platform takes a percentage. This is the core income stream. Higher-priced items bring higher earnings for the platform.
2. Listing Fees
Sellers may pay a small fee to list items. It ensures seriousness. It reduces spam and low-quality listings. It also offers small but consistent revenue.
3. Premium Memberships
You can offer paid memberships. Benefits may include early access to releases, fast authentication, higher visibility for their listings or reduced commission. Enthusiasts may pay for a smoother selling or buying experience.
4. Advertisements and Promotions
Brands or sellers can pay to feature their products. You can show banner ads, sponsored listings, and email marketing campaigns. It is another effective revenue route.
5. Affiliate Marketing
You may partner with fashion brands or accessories sellers. Through an affiliate link, you can earn commission when users buy related products. This adds passive income.
6. Logistics and Shipping Fees
If you provide shipping or handling services, you can charge fees. You ensure product safety and faster delivery. Users pay extra for convenience and peace of mind.

The Average Cost to Build a Marketplace App Like GOAT
The cost will depend on the complexity of the features, the design region of the developers, and other factors. Below, you will get a complete explanation of the cost to develop an app like GOAT.
Basic Version
A simple version with core features costs around $5,000 to $7,000. This includes user sign-up, listing payment integration, search, and a basic seller dashboard. It is enough to launch a minimal viable product. You can test the market. You can get real users. You can gather feedback.
Medium Level Features
Add more features, such as push notifications in app chat, seller dashboards, authentication, and basic analytics. That may cost between $10,000 and $15,000. You get a smoother experience. You reduce user friction. You add trust and convenience.
Advanced Customized Version
To include virtual try-on AI suggestions, real-time bidding, international currency support, premium memberships, a rich seller dashboard, and admin analytics, you may spend around $25,000 to $30,000. That builds a full-scale platform that rivals GOAT in functionality.
Ongoing Maintenance and Updates
After the launch, experienced and reputable software development companies continue to maintain ongoing improvements to the app. You increase safety, add features, address errors, and users respond to input. Generally, 15% to 25% of the original growth cost is used for annual maintenance. This guarantees the constant stability, safety and modernity of the platform.
